Most people NC prefer to stop doing Daylight Saving Time
High Point University surveyed 1,000 adults in North Carolina about their feelings about the twice-a-year time change. By a two-to-one margin, they'd prefer to stop doing it. Every year, North Carolina lawmakers file bills to do that, but it would take federal action to make it happen.
